大家好,如果您還對簡述創建視圖的作用不太了解,沒有關系,今天就由本站為大家分享簡述創建視圖的作用的知識,包括視圖的用途和作用的問題都會給大家分析到,還望可以解決大家的問題,下面我們就開始吧!
透視對我們繪畫有什么作用
藝術家在二維平面(一張紙或畫布)上表示三維物體(遠景)使其看起來自然而真實。透視可以在平面上創造一種空間和深度的幻覺。
透視最常見的是指線性透視,即使用會聚線和消失點的視錯覺,這種視錯覺使物體在離觀察者越遠的地方顯得越小。從空中或大氣的角度看,遠處的東西比前景中的東西更亮,色調更冷。另一種透視法是通過壓縮或縮短物體的長度使物體后退到遠處。
透視應用是19世紀初意大利佛羅倫薩文藝復興時期發展起來的西方藝術。在此之前,繪畫是程式化和象征性的,而不是現實生活的表現。例如,一幅畫中一個人的大小可能表明他們相對于其他人物的重要性和地位,而不是他們與觀眾的接近程度,而單個顏色的意義超出了他們的想象。
線性透視使用一種幾何系統,該系統由眼睛水平的水平線、消失點和向消失點會聚的線組成,稱為正交線,以在二維表面上重建空間和距離的幻覺。文藝復興時期的藝術家菲利波·布魯內列斯基被廣泛認為是線性透視的發現者。
三種基本類型的透視——一點、兩點和三點——是指用于創建透視錯覺的消失點的數量。兩點透視法是最常用的。
一點透視法由一個消失點組成,當對象的一側(如建筑物)平行于圖片平面(想象透過窗戶看)時,它會重新創建視圖。
兩點透視法在對象的任一側使用一個消失點,例如建筑物的角面向觀察者的繪畫。
三點透視法適用于從上方或下方觀察的主題。三個消失點描繪了三個方向上透視的效果。
大多數有經驗的藝術家都可以直觀地畫出透視圖。他們不需要畫水平線、消失點和正交線。
向視圖是什么意思
向視圖是數據庫中的一個非實際存在的虛擬表,它是通過對一個或多個實際表進行特殊查詢而創建的。向視圖查詢數據與查詢實際表的方式相同,但其實際上并不存儲任何數據,而是通過實時查詢相關表獲得數據。所以,向視圖不能被獨立地更新或修改數據,只能通過修改包含在其中的實際表來實現數據的更新。因此,向視圖的使用可以簡化數據訪問,提高查詢效率和數據安全性。
任何用戶都可以創建視圖對嗎
都可以的。
視圖可以從原有的表上選取對用戶有用的信息,那些對用戶沒用,或者用戶沒有權限了解的信息,都可以直接屏蔽掉,作用類似于篩選。這樣做既使應用簡單化,也保證了系統的安全。
oracle視圖有什么用呢
視圖(view)定義:
視圖是一張虛表,不占用物理空間(指的是圖中數據不占用,視圖本身定義語句還是存在硬盤中)
視圖是從一個或多個實際表中獲得的,這些表的數據存放在數據庫中。那些用于產生視圖的表叫做該視圖的基表。一個視圖也可以從另一個視圖中產生。
視圖的定義存在數據庫中,與此定義相關的數據并沒有再存一份于數據庫中。通過視圖看到的數據存放在基表中。
視圖看上去非常像數據庫的物理表,對它的操作同任何其他的表(增、刪、改、查)。當通過修改視圖修改數據時,實際是在改變基表中的數據;相反的,基表中數據的改變也會自動反應到由基表產生的視圖中。由于邏輯上的原因,有些Oracle視圖可以修改對應的基表,有些則不能(僅能查詢)。
視圖的作用:將一些查詢復雜的SQL語句變為視圖,便于查詢。 視圖的創建:語法:在CREATEVIEW語句后加入子查詢。 舉個栗子--> 查詢視圖時,不需要再寫完全的查詢語句,只需要簡單的寫上從視圖中查詢的語句就可以了 視圖也可以從視圖中產生: 修改視圖的數據,就是修改基表的數據: 視圖的刪除:當視圖不在需要時,用“dropviow”撤銷,刪掉視圖不會導致數據丟失(不會影響基表的數據),因為視圖是基于數據庫的表之上的一個查詢定義(虛表)視圖的優點:可以使某些重復出現SQL語句變得更為簡單 視圖的缺點:1.如果修改基表的結構,視圖失效 2.增加數據庫的維護成本 3.視圖會被覆蓋掉 4.一般情況下,不要對視圖進行DML操作
1.是否可以在創建視圖時采用ORDER BY子句為什么
這個要看你是什么數據庫的。Oracle可以創建視圖的時候,在里面的sql加orderby.例如:SQL>createviewv_testasselect*fromtest_mainorderbyid;視圖已建立。但是同樣的語句,SQLServer就不行了。例如:1>createviewv_testasselect*fromtest_mainorderbyid2>go消息1033,級別15,狀態1,服務器TESTPC\SQLEXPRESS,過程v_test,第1行除非另外還指定了TOP或FORXML,否則,ORDERBY子句在視圖、內聯函數、派生表、子查詢和公用表表達式中無效。
視圖可以建立在視圖上嗎
可以,視圖建立好以后,視圖名稱其實也就是一個表名而已
好了,文章到此結束,希望可以幫助到大家。